Clone and Expression Analysis of a Novel S-allele: S35-RNase in Pyrusbretschneideri

Abstract: A new self2incompatibility gene, which contains an open reading frame of 681 nucleotides en
coding a 227 amino acid protein, was isolated from Pyrus bretschneideri cultivars of Zaosu by rap id amp lifica
tion of cDNA ends (RACE). DNA sequece analysis revealed that the isolated gene contains the specific se
quences of S-RNase, such as conserved histidines and cysteines, hypervariable region and conserved regions.
It displayed the highest homology of 94% with the embodied S4-RNase (AB014072). The new S-allele was
named S35-RNase and its accession number wasDQ224344 in GenBank. The northern blot analysis indicated
that this gene only exp ressed in p istil, with a higher exp ression level at the balloon stage than at the stage of 3
days before or after flowering.
